A Legacy Baked Into Every Crumb
In 1983, Steve Jacobs made a bold decision: he left a career in Higher Education to start a home food service business delivering meats and seafood directly to families across Massachusetts. It was a leap of faith — and it came with an unexpected twist.
With every order, Steve included a freshly baked coffee cake as a thank-you gift for his customers. He never imagined what would happen next. Before long, customers began calling not for meats or seafood, but for the cake. "Just the cake for now," they'd say. And the direction of his life changed forever.
For years, Steve operated as The Gypsy Baking Company — a fitting name for a baker without a home kitchen of his own. Every Sunday, he would travel up to 50 miles to rent shuttered bakeries for the day, mixing and baking his cakes before sunrise, then delivering them fresh. It was an extraordinary commitment to a craft he had come to love.
In 1999, that wandering chapter came to a close. Steve established a permanent, 3,000 square foot production facility in Milford, Massachusetts — a real home for a bakery that had earned one. The Boston Tea Cake Company was officially rooted, and the cakes that once traveled town-to-town in the back of a car could now ship across the entire country.
Today, every cake is still made from scratch using the same devotion to quality that turned a free gift into a calling. We operate a 100% nut-free bakery facility and use only kosher-certified ingredients — because a cake this special should be one that everyone can enjoy.
